diff --git a/components/psDetail.vue b/components/psDetail.vue index 7b4c0b6..3714898 100644 --- a/components/psDetail.vue +++ b/components/psDetail.vue @@ -217,7 +217,15 @@ - + {{ item.groupDesc }} ({{ item.qty?parseInt(item.qty):'0'}}) @@ -433,9 +441,9 @@ immediate: true, // 初次监听即执行 }, methods: { - gotocxDetail(instno,project){ + gotocxDetail(instno,project,type){ uni.navigateTo({ - url: `/pages/pallet/tpcxtk?instno=${instno}&project=${project}` + url: `/pages/pallet/tpcxtk?instno=${instno}&project=${project}&type={type}` }); }, _initDetail(palletAll = this.palletAll) { diff --git a/pages/pallet/js.vue b/pages/pallet/js.vue index 6dd903d..971cf38 100644 --- a/pages/pallet/js.vue +++ b/pages/pallet/js.vue @@ -58,10 +58,10 @@ - - + --> @@ -386,7 +386,10 @@ export default { // console.log(Compressor) const Compressor1 = new Compressor(file, { quality: 0.3, // 压缩质量,范围是0-1 +<<<<<<< HEAD convertSize: 1048576, // 如果大于1M(1024*1024)进行压缩 转换后的图片大小,单位是字节。如果图片大小小于这个值,则不进行压缩。 +======= +>>>>>>> e53878004c989de2e23cc181dc0c247667489fee success: (compressedFile) => { // console.log("compressedFile",compressedFile) // 读取压缩后的图片文件为base64 diff --git a/pages/pallet/ps.vue b/pages/pallet/ps.vue index 5dcf45a..a92508a 100644 --- a/pages/pallet/ps.vue +++ b/pages/pallet/ps.vue @@ -128,7 +128,7 @@ *配送单照片 @@ -404,6 +404,7 @@ export default { deliveryCar:'',// 车牌号 files: [], deliveryPhoto:[], // 配送单图片 + deliveryPhoto0:[], departCode:"", workshop:"", location:"", @@ -600,7 +601,10 @@ export default { return new Promise((resolve, reject) => { new Compressor(file, { quality: 0.3, // 压缩质量,范围是0-1 +<<<<<<< HEAD convertSize: 1048576, // 如果大于1M(1024*1024)进行压缩 转换后的图片大小,单位是字节。如果图片大小小于这个值,则不进行压缩。 +======= +>>>>>>> e53878004c989de2e23cc181dc0c247667489fee success: (compressedFile) => { // 读取压缩后的图片文件为base64 const reader = new FileReader(); @@ -668,7 +672,7 @@ export default { const base64 = evt.target.result.substr(22) console.log("base64",base64) resolve(base64) - that.itemList.deliveryPhoto[index]['url']="data:image/png;base64"+base64; + that.itemList.deliveryPhoto0[index]['url']="data:image/png;base64"+base64; that.$forceUpdate(); }; @@ -689,14 +693,17 @@ export default { return new Promise((resolve, reject) => { new Compressor(file, { quality: 0.3, // 压缩质量,范围是0-1 +<<<<<<< HEAD convertSize: 1048576, // 如果大于1M(1024*1024)进行压缩 转换后的图片大小,单位是字节。如果图片大小小于这个值,则不进行压缩。 +======= +>>>>>>> e53878004c989de2e23cc181dc0c247667489fee success: (compressedFile) => { // 读取压缩后的图片文件为base64 const reader = new FileReader(); reader.onload = (e) => { const base64 = e.target.result; resolve(base64); - that.itemList.deliveryPhoto[index]={ + that.itemList.deliveryPhoto0[index]={ url:base64 }; that.$forceUpdate(); @@ -1281,7 +1288,7 @@ export default { return false } - if(!this.itemList.deliveryPhoto||this.itemList.deliveryPhoto.length<1){ + if(!this.itemList.deliveryPhoto0&&this.itemList.deliveryPhoto0.length<1){ this.$refs.uToast.show({ title: "请上传配送单图片!", type: "warning", @@ -1292,9 +1299,10 @@ export default { // 配送单图片 this.itemList.files=[]; - this.itemList.deliveryPhoto.forEach(item=>{ + this.itemList.deliveryPhoto0.forEach(item=>{ this.itemList.files.push(item.url); }); + this.itemList.deliveryPhoto=this.itemList.files this.$forceUpdate(); var data=[]; diff --git a/pages/pallet/xp.vue b/pages/pallet/xp.vue index 8bd543a..477f726 100644 --- a/pages/pallet/xp.vue +++ b/pages/pallet/xp.vue @@ -68,10 +68,10 @@ - - + --> @@ -392,7 +392,10 @@ export default { return new Promise((resolve, reject) => { new Compressor(file, { quality: 0.3, // 压缩质量,范围是0-1 +<<<<<<< HEAD convertSize: 1048576, // 如果大于1M(1024*1024)进行压缩 转换后的图片大小,单位是字节。如果图片大小小于这个值,则不进行压缩。 +======= +>>>>>>> e53878004c989de2e23cc181dc0c247667489fee success: (compressedFile) => { // 读取压缩后的图片文件为base64 const reader = new FileReader(); diff --git a/pages/pallet/yz.vue b/pages/pallet/yz.vue index 6444d78..50e8929 100644 --- a/pages/pallet/yz.vue +++ b/pages/pallet/yz.vue @@ -454,7 +454,10 @@ export default { return new Promise((resolve, reject) => { new Compressor(file, { quality: 0.3, // 压缩质量,范围是0-1 +<<<<<<< HEAD convertSize: 1048576, // 如果大于1M(1024*1024)进行压缩 转换后的图片大小,单位是字节。如果图片大小小于这个值,则不进行压缩。 +======= +>>>>>>> e53878004c989de2e23cc181dc0c247667489fee success: (compressedFile) => { // 读取压缩后的图片文件为base64 const reader = new FileReader();